Does anyone know how to perform this kind of sorting in excel?

13, 8, 7, 7, 14, 14, 14, 3, 3, 3, 23, 19, 2, 2

The above values are listed from cell A1 to A14
A1 has a higher priority than A2 on selection, and A14 has the lowest
priority on selection, because it located on the bottom of the list. I need
to select the top five numbers from the list without duplication, but the
distance between any two numbers must be bigger than / [equal to] the
smallest value from the list. On the other words, 2 is the smallest number
from the list,

13, 8, 7, 7, 14, 14, 14, 3, 3, 3, 23, 19, 2, 2
the first number is 13 for selection, and
[13]

13, 8, 7, 7, 14, 14, 14, 3, 3, 3, 23, 19, 2, 2
the second number is 8, which 13-8=5 and is bigger than / equal to the
smallest number 2.
[13 8]

13, 8, 7, 7, 14, 14, 14, 3, 3, 3, 23, 19, 2, 2
the third number cannot be 7, because abs(8-7)=1, which is less than the
smallest number 2, even through abs(13-7)=6, which is bigger than 2.
the next third number cannot be 7 again, then skip it for the next one.
the next third number cannot be 14, because abs(13-14)=1, which is less than
2.
....
the next third number is 3, abs(13-3)=10, abs(8-3)=5, which is bigger than 2
[13 8 3]

13, 8, 7, 7, 14, 14, 14, 3, 3, 3, 23, 19, 2, 2
the next forth number is 23, which is OK, abs(13-23)=10, abs(8-23)=15, which
is bigger than 2
[13 8 3 23]

13, 8, 7, 7, 14, 14, 14, 3, 3, 3, 23, 19, 2, 2
the next fifth number is 19, abs(13-19)=6, abs(8-19)=11, abs(23-19)=4,
abs(3-19)=16

[13 8 3 23 19] DONE, which values are stored in cell B1 to B5

Eric,
Not well tested, but may be this ;
Private Sub CommandButton2_Click()
Dim RetVals() As Long
Dim i As Long

RetVals = SortSpecial(Range("rngData").Value)

For i = LBound(RetVals) To UBound(RetVals)
Debug.Print RetVals(i)
Next

End Sub

Private Function SortSpecial(InData As Variant) As Long()
Dim OutArray() As Long
Dim LArray As Long
Dim UArray As Long
Dim MinValue As Long ' Single
Dim i As Long
Dim j As Long
Dim UniqueCount As Long

LArray = LBound(InData, 1)
UArray = UBound(InData, 1)

'Avoid many Redim Preserve, assume 100% required
ReDim OutArray(LArray To UArray)

'Get the Minimum value
MinValue = Application.Min(Range("rngData"))

'First value is always valid
OutArray(LArray) = InData(LArray, 1)
UniqueCount = LArray

For i = LArray + 1 To UArray
'make sure it is NOT the minimum value
If (InData(i, 1) <> MinValue) Then
'See if it meets the minimum difference requirement
For j = LArray To UniqueCount
If (Abs(InData(i, 1) - OutArray(j)) <= MinValue) Then
GoTo BreakOut
End If
Next

'See if we have that value already
For j = LArray To UniqueCount
If InData(i, 1) = OutArray(j) Then
GoTo BreakOut
End If
Next
UniqueCount = UniqueCount + 1
OutArray(UniqueCount) = InData(i, 1)
BreakOut:
End If
Next

'Redim to remove unused elements
ReDim Preserve OutArray(LArray To UniqueCount)
SortSpecial = OutArray()

End Function

Slight correction;

You should of course being using
'Get the Minimum value
MinValue = Application.Min(InData)

And I suppose you should delete
'First value is always valid
OutArray(LArray) = InData(LArray, 1)
UniqueCount = LArray

And change to
For i = LArray To UArray

And add error/array checking.

If you don't mind using helper columns, try this.

put in B1
=A1
then put B1
{=IF(MIN(ABS(B$1:B1-A2))>=MIN(A$1:A$14),A2,A2+MAX(A$1:A$14))}
this is a array formula(Ctrl+Shift+enter), and copy B2 down to B14.

put C1
=IF(A1=B1,ROW(),"")
and copy C1 down to C14.

put D1
=IF(ISERROR(SMALL(C$1:C$14,ROW())),"",INDEX(A$1:A$14,SMALL(C$1:C$14,ROW())))
and copy D1 down to C14.

this will populate 13 8 3 23 19 in D1:D5
